Mission: Provide therapeutic horseback riding for disabled.
Programs: The j. F. Shea therapeutic riding center, inc. (the shea center), home of the fran joswick therapeutic riding program, is a nonprofit california corporation, organized in 1979. The shea center provides therapeutic riding and equine assisted therapy, which are medically recognized forms of therapeutic intervention for a number of disabilities. The shea center's clients have cognitive or physical disabilities, such as cerebral palsy, learning disabilities, down syndrome, multiple sclerosis, spinal cord or head injuries, and autism. The shea center has partnerships with other service organizations and local school districts, and is also an international training facility for the industry.
